DESCRIPTION:Nuclear transitions of low energy can couple efficiently to th
 e atomic shell in a variety of processes such as internal conversion\, its
  inverse process nuclear excitation by electron capture\, nuclear excitati
 on by electron transition or electronic bridge. The talk will illustrate a
  few such examples involving highly charged ions. First\, the talk will di
 scuss the current status of nuclear excitation by electron capture experim
 ents and recent proposals. Second\, it will follow theoretical development
 s on employing electronic bridge processes for the driving the nuclear clo
 ck transition in 229-Th. This nucleus possesses the lowest known nuclear t
 ransition energy and promises a novel and unprecedently precise nuclear cl
 ock.\n\nhttps://indico.ijclab.in2p3.fr/event/13876/
